Background
The water filtering device is one of the common fittings in the water treatment industry, and the precise filtration refers to a filtration treatment process for removing fine suspended matters or colloidal particles which cannot be removed by the sand filtration in water, and is commonly used as a pretreatment device for preparing ultrapure water in the water supply treatment.

In another embodiment, as shown in fig. 2 and 3, a support frame 15 is fixedly installed on the outer surface of the filter screen 2, a bracket 16 is fixedly installed on the inner wall of the filter box 1, the lower surface of the support frame 15 is closely attached to the upper surface of the bracket 16, and by providing the support frame 15 and the bracket 16, the filter screen 2 can be stably inserted into the filter box 1.
When needs clearance filter screen 2, open sealed lid 4, upwards take out filter screen 2, let the lower surface of support frame 15 leave the upper surface of bracket 16, the device's setting can make filter screen 2 have the effect of being convenient for erect the installation, can clear up after filtering, even the situation of jam appears, also can directly take out, can not make waste water and impurity remix.

In another embodiment, as shown in fig. 1 and 4, a filter head 13 is screwed to one end of the water outlet pipe 8 far away from the second water outlet pipe 7, and the filter head 13 is convenient to detach for cleaning by arranging the screwed filter head 13 to facilitate the secondary filtration of the discharged wastewater.
When outlet pipe 8 begins the drainage, need close second inlet tube 9 earlier, when water flows out through filter head 13, can be filtered once more, and it can to take off the rotatory clearance of taking down of the surface of outlet pipe 8 with filter head 13 after the filtration.
In another embodiment, as shown in fig. 1 and 4, the filter head 13 is composed of a fixing sleeve 17, a through groove 18, a filter element 19, and a thread groove 20, wherein the thread groove 20 in threaded connection with the water outlet pipe 8 is formed on one side surface of the fixing sleeve 17 facing the water outlet pipe 8, the through groove 18 is formed at one end of the inner wall of the fixing sleeve 17, the filter element 19 is tightly attached to the inner wall of the through groove 18, and the filter head 13 is composed of the fixing sleeve 17, the through groove 18, the filter element 19, and the thread groove 20, so that the filter element 19 can be detached and replaced independently after the filter head 13 is detached.
After the filtration is finished, the fixing sleeve 17 is turned down from one end of the water outlet pipe 8, and then the filter element 19 is pulled out from the inner wall of the through groove 18 for cleaning and replacement.
In another embodiment, as shown in fig. 1 and 2, a groove matched with the diameter of the top cover 3 is formed in the lower surface of the sealing cover 4, and by arranging the groove, the sealing cover 4 can be fixed on the top surface of the filter box 1, so that the top cover 3 can be conveniently placed, and the top cover 3 is prevented from being damaged due to extrusion.
When the sealing cover 4 is installed, the bottom surface groove of the sealing cover 4 is arranged right above the top cover 3, and then the flanges are fixedly connected through bolts.
